Getting There

  • Public Transport - Bus

    From Surabaya's main bus terminal, Terminal Bungurasih, take a bus heading to the city center. Look for buses labeled 'Dari Terminal Bungurasih ke Surabaya'. Once you arrive at the city center, get off at the 'Tunjungan Plaza' stop. From there, walk towards Jl. Tunjungan and continue straight until you reach the intersection with Jl. Mangga. Turn left onto Jl. Mangga, and you will find Museum W.R. Soepratman at No. 21, just a short walk down the road.

  • Public Transport - Angkot (Minibus)

    If you are near Jl. Pahlawan, look for an Angkot (public minibus) marked with 'Kota' or 'D' that heads towards Jl. Mangga. Board the Angkot and pay the fare (around IDR 5,000). Inform the driver that you wish to get off at Jl. Mangga. Once you arrive, walk a few meters to find Museum W.R. Soepratman at Jl. Mangga No. 21.

  • Walking

    If you are already in the Tambaksari area or nearby, you can simply walk to Museum W.R. Soepratman. Head towards Jl. Mangga and look for the museum at No. 21. The museum is easily accessible by foot, and you can enjoy the local scenery along the way.

  • Ride-Hailing Service

    Use a ride-hailing app like Gojek or Grab. Open the app, set your pick-up location, and enter 'Museum W.R. Soepratman' or its address: Jl. Mangga No.21, Tambaksari, Surabaya, Jawa Timur 60136. Confirm the ride and wait for your driver to arrive. This is a convenient option if you prefer door-to-door service.

Discover more about Museum W.R. Soepratman

Museum W.R. Soepratman stands as a beacon of Indonesian culture and history in Surabaya, East Java. Dedicated to the legacy of W.R. Soepratman, a pivotal figure in the Indonesian independence movement, the museum provides an insightful look into his life and contributions. Visitors can explore a range of exhibits that feature artifacts, photographs, and documents that chronicle Indonesia's journey to independence, allowing for a deep understanding of the nation's rich heritage. The museum's layout is thoughtfully designed to guide guests through various periods of history, offering an immersive experience. Beyond its historical significance, the museum also serves as a cultural hub, hosting events and exhibitions that celebrate Indonesian art and traditions. The friendly staff members are eager to share knowledge and stories, enhancing the visitor experience. The museum is not just a place for reflection but also a venue for learning, making it an ideal stop for tourists of all ages. With its intimate setting, the museum allows visitors to engage with the displays at their own pace, making it an enriching experience. For those looking to explore the local culture, the museum is conveniently located near other attractions in Surabaya, making it easy to include in a day of sightseeing. Whether you are a history enthusiast or simply curious about Indonesian culture, Museum W.R. Soepratman promises an enlightening visit that will leave you with a deeper appreciation for the nation's past.
